“In case you really feel actually caught in your wardrobe, get something out and set it on a rail— buy a rail—after which make 4 piles. The primary goes to be factors that you just don each single solitary working day, however you’re so bored by, you’re expertise invisible. The second pile is heading to be issues which are really costly that you just invested in however not often at any time placed on. The third is issues that you just admire the colour of, however you recognize the design is just not flattering to your system situation. And the final pile is issues that you just critically under no circumstances use given that it’s probably a lot too main or as nicely little.
So the first pile, I would like you to do away with. I would like you to not have that fallback place in your wardrobe and that’s probably the most troublesome matter to do. The second only one is thrilling primarily as a result of that is during which you made the largest funding choice in your wardrobe. Presumably it’s that stunning sequinned robe you acquired on your buddy’s marriage ceremony day. What you wish to do is make it wearable for the daytime. Costume it down, place a sweater over it and make it into an answer skirt. However simply costume in it, or else it’s painful each time you go in your wardrobe. For the third an individual, there’s a various, primarily as a result of if the color is fabulous, you possibly can modify the shape. Take just a little bit off the bottom and set it in your waistband to cut back it. If just a little one thing is manner too small, chop it off and make it into a number one. If trousers are too intensive or a odd form, crop them and so they’ll purchase on a whole new search. Use them with a white coach and you’ll grow to be an ageless girl. For the final pile, actually do not reside with distinctive dimensions in your wardrobe. If a wardrobe is about-stuffed, you infrequently make a selection. But when a wardrobe is absolutely empty, you then costume in all these clothes rather more and you’ll seem at what you’re donning and see what makes you go, ‘If I solely skilled this issue to make these matter perform superior.’ And which is what you exit and get.”
